Traffic Light (TV series) Traffic Light. (TV series) Traffic Light is an American sitcom television series that ran on Fox from February 8, 2011 to May 31, 2011. [ 1] It is based on the Israeli television series Ramzor ( Hebrew: רמזור, lit. "traffic light"; by Keshet Broadcasting Ltd. ), and was adapted to an American audience by Bob Fisher.

Ramzor. Ramzor (Hebrew: רַמְזוֹר; lit. Traffic Light) is an Israeli sitcom. The program was created by Adir Miller, who also co-authored the screenplay (along with Ran Sarig) and also appears in the program in the leading role. The series ran for four seasons on Israeli Channel 2 (on Keshet) between 2008–2014.

Tim Riggins. Timothy "Tim" Riggins is a character in sports drama Friday Night Lights, portrayed by actor Taylor Kitsch. Tim Riggins is the fullback / running back of the Dillon Panthers in the television series. His character is similar to Don Billingsley from the original book and 2004 film Friday Night Lights.

season 11. The eleventh season of Two and a Half Men premiered on CBS on September 26, 2013, and ended on May 8, 2014. This season marks another major change in the series as Amber Tamblyn joins the cast as Jenny, Charlie 's illegitimate daughter. [1] Tamblyn was promoted to series regular on October 2, 2013. [2]
